SN74HC374PWT Equivalent & Substitute Parts
Part Overview
The SN74HC374PWT is a D-type flip-flop logic integrated circuit manufactured by Texas Instruments, featuring 1 element with 8-bit positive edge triggering in a 20-TSSOP surface mount package. This part is discontinued at DiGi Electronics, necessitating identification of equivalent and substitute components that maintain functional compatibility while meeting current supply chain requirements. Substitute parts must preserve the core logic function, package form factor, and electrical operating parameters within acceptable tolerances for direct circuit board replacement.

Key Parameters
| Parameter | Value |
|---|---|
| Type | D-Type Flip Flop |
| Number of Elements | 1 |
| Number of Bits per Element | 8 |
| Output Type | Tri-State, Non-Inverted |
| Trigger Type | Positive Edge |
| Package / Case | 20-TSSOP (0.173", 4.40mm Width) |
| Mounting Type | Surface Mount |
| Voltage - Supply | 2V ~ 6V |
| Operating Temperature | -40°C ~ 85°C (TA) |
| RoHS Status | ROHS3 Compliant |
Substitute Part Grouping Explanation
Substitution eligibility is determined by strict adherence to the following parameters: identical package type (20-TSSOP), matching logic function (D-type flip-flop, 8-bit, positive edge triggered), compatible output configuration (tri-state, non-inverted), overlapping supply voltage range (minimum 2V ~ 6V), and surface mount mounting type. Parts are grouped into three categories based on parametric equivalence and manufacturer status.
Parametric Equivalents maintain all critical electrical specifications within the original operating envelope, differing only in packaging format (tape & reel versus cut tape) or product status (active versus discontinued). These parts are direct functional replacements.
Direct Manufacturer Alternatives originate from different manufacturers but meet the core functional and package requirements. Variations in clock frequency, propagation delay, quiescent current, and input capacitance are noted but do not preclude substitution when application timing margins accommodate the differences.
Manufacturer-Recommended Alternatives represent higher-performance or enhanced-specification variants from the 74HC, 74AHC, and 74VHC logic families. These parts offer improved speed, lower power consumption, or extended temperature ranges while maintaining package compatibility and functional equivalence.
Parameter Comparison
| Part Number | Manufacturer | Series | Clock Frequency (MHz) | Max Propagation Delay @ 6V, 50pF (ns) | Current - Quiescent (µA) | Voltage - Supply (V) | Operating Temperature (°C) | Product Status | Packaging |
|---|---|---|---|---|---|---|---|---|---|
| SN74HC374PWT | Texas Instruments | 74HC | 70 | 31 | 8 | 2 ~ 6 | -40 ~ 85 | Discontinued | Cut Tape (CT) & Digi-Reel® |
| SN74HC374APWR | Texas Instruments | 74HC | 70 | 31 | 8 | 2 ~ 6 | -40 ~ 85 | Active | Tape & Reel (TR) |
| SN74HC374PWR | Texas Instruments | 74HC | 70 | 31 | 8 | 2 ~ 6 | -40 ~ 85 | Active | Cut Tape (CT) & Digi-Reel® |
| MC74HC374ADTR2G | onsemi | 74HC | 35 | 21 | 4 | 2 ~ 6 | -55 ~ 125 | Active | Tape & Reel (TR) |
| MM74HC374MTCX | onsemi | 74HC | 35 | 40 | 8 | 2 ~ 6 | -40 ~ 85 | Active | Tape & Reel (TR) |
| 74AHC374PW,118 | Nexperia USA Inc. | 74AHC | 120 | 10.1 | 4 | 2 ~ 5.5 | -40 ~ 125 | Active | Tape & Reel (TR) |
| 74AHC574PW,118 | Nexperia USA Inc. | 74AHC | 115 | 10.6 | 4 | 2 ~ 5.5 | -40 ~ 125 | Active | Tape & Reel (TR) |
| 74HC374PW,118 | Nexperia USA Inc. | 74HC | 83 | 28 | 4 | 2 ~ 6 | -40 ~ 125 | Active | Tape & Reel (TR) |
| 74VHC574MTC | Fairchild Semiconductor | 74VHC | 115 | 10.6 | 4 | 2 ~ 5.5 | -40 ~ 85 | Active | - |
| 74VHC574MTCX | onsemi | 74VHC | 115 | 10.6 | 4 | 2 ~ 5.5 | -40 ~ 85 | Active | Tape & Reel (TR) |
| MC74HC374ADTG | onsemi | 74HC | 35 | 21 | 4 | 2 ~ 6 | -55 ~ 125 | Obsolete | - |
Engineering Selection Recommendations
Tier 1 - Direct Parametric Equivalents (Preferred)
SN74HC374APWR and SN74HC374PWR are Texas Instruments parts with identical electrical specifications to the SN74HC374PWT. Both are active products with ROHS3 compliance and unlimited moisture sensitivity rating. SN74HC374PWR matches the original cut tape packaging format, while SN74HC374APWR is supplied in tape & reel format. Selection between these two depends on procurement quantity and packaging requirements.
Tier 2 - Functional Equivalents with Extended Specifications
74HC374PW,118 (Nexperia) maintains 74HC series compatibility with extended operating temperature range (-40°C to 125°C) and improved clock frequency (83 MHz). This part is suitable for applications requiring wider temperature operation. MC74HC374ADTR2G (onsemi) offers extended temperature range (-55°C to 125°C) with lower quiescent current (4 µA) and faster propagation delay (21 ns), making it appropriate for temperature-critical or power-sensitive applications.
Tier 3 - Higher-Performance Alternatives
74AHC374PW,118 and 74AHC574PW,118 (Nexperia) represent the 74AHC family with significantly improved speed (120 MHz and 115 MHz respectively) and reduced propagation delay (10.1 ns and 10.6 ns). These parts operate at 2V ~ 5.5V supply range and are suitable for high-speed applications. 74VHC574MTCX (onsemi) and 74VHC574MTC (Fairchild) provide 74VHC series performance with 115 MHz clock frequency and 10.6 ns propagation delay, also within 2V ~ 5.5V supply range.
All recommended substitutes maintain ROHS3 compliance, 20-TSSOP package compatibility, and tri-state non-inverted output configuration. Selection should account for application timing requirements, supply voltage constraints, and temperature operating envelope.
Frequently Asked Questions (FAQ)
Q: Can SN74HC374APWR directly replace SN74HC374PWT on existing circuit boards?
A: Yes. SN74HC374APWR is a parametric equivalent with identical electrical specifications, package type (20-TSSOP), and functional configuration. The only difference is packaging format (tape & reel versus cut tape). No circuit modifications are required.
Q: What is the difference between 74HC and 74AHC series parts?
A: The 74AHC series offers improved performance characteristics: higher clock frequency (120 MHz versus 70 MHz), faster propagation delay (10.1 ns versus 31 ns), and lower quiescent current (4 µA versus 8 µA). However, 74AHC parts operate at reduced maximum supply voltage (5.5V versus 6V). Both series maintain the same package and functional configuration.
Q: Are 74VHC574 parts compatible with 74HC374 designs?
A: 74VHC574 parts are functionally equivalent D-type flip-flops with 8-bit configuration and tri-state output in the same 20-TSSOP package. They operate within 2V ~ 5.5V supply range with superior speed performance (115 MHz, 10.6 ns propagation delay). Compatibility depends on application supply voltage and timing requirements. Designs operating at 6V supply voltage cannot use 74VHC parts.
Q: What does "discontinued" status mean for the SN74HC374PWT?
A: Discontinued status indicates the part is no longer manufactured or actively distributed by the original manufacturer. Existing inventory may be available from component distributors, but long-term supply is not guaranteed. Active equivalent parts should be selected for new designs or when existing stock is depleted.
Q: Can MM74HC374MTCX be used as a direct replacement?
A: MM74HC374MTCX is functionally compatible but exhibits different electrical characteristics: lower clock frequency (35 MHz versus 70 MHz) and longer propagation delay (40 ns versus 31 ns). It is suitable for applications with relaxed timing requirements. For timing-critical circuits, SN74HC374APWR or SN74HC374PWR are preferred.
Q: What packaging format should be selected for production assembly?
A: Tape & reel (TR) packaging is standard for automated pick-and-place assembly. Cut tape (CT) & Digi-Reel® format is suitable for manual assembly or lower-volume applications. SN74HC374PWR provides cut tape format matching the original part. SN74HC374APWR provides tape & reel format for high-volume production.
Q: Are all substitute parts ROHS3 compliant?
A: All active substitute parts listed are ROHS3 compliant. MC74HC374ADTG is marked obsolete and should not be selected for new designs. Compliance certification is maintained across all recommended Tier 1 and Tier 2 alternatives.
